Guccihighwaters‘ (Morgan Murphy) latest single “lately” is Murphy at his best, featuring an expansive, multigenre sound that is equally as sad rap as it is indie pop. Warm, fuzzy pianos & lo-fi beats paint a melancholic atmosphere, eventually building into a melodic chorus that swells with emotion. Murphy’s emo lyrics, sad boy aesthetic, and self-produced lo-fi beats put the listener in their feels with “lately,” adding to his impressive collection of catchy bangers that streams 2M+ per week.
